Covers the roots of Hinduism, and Hindu customs and beliefs. This book also covers Hindu gods and devotionalism, Hindu rites of passage, the Hindu nationalist movement in India, Hinduism and the interfaith movement, and Hinduism and the environmental movement.
One of the oldest and most complex of the worlds spiritual traditions, Hinduism is the religion of more than four-fifths of the Indian subcontinents population. Major Hindu communities also exist around the world. Dispelling many of the myths and mysteries surrounding this ancient world religion, "Hinduism, Fourth Edition" provides readers with an up-to-date understanding of the interconnection of religion and politics in India, problems facing Hindu communities in the diaspora, and American movements in Hinduism.
